Answer:
y = 11/20
Step-by-step explanation:
-4/5 + y = -1/4
Add 4/5 to each side
-4/5 +4/5 + y = -1/4+4/5
y = -1/4 + 4/5
Get a common denominator
y = -1/4 *5/5 + 4/5 *4/4
y = -5/20 + 16/20
y = 11/20
Check
-4/5 +11/20 = -1/4
Get a common denominator
-4/5*4/4 + 11/20 = -1/4*5/5
-16/20 +11/20 = -5/20
-5/20 = - 5/20
